VideoCategories: list

傳回可以與 YouTube 影片建立關聯的類別清單。

配額影響:呼叫這個方法的配額為 1 個單位。

常見用途

要求

HTTP 要求

GET https://www.googleapis.com/youtube/v3/videoCategories

參數

下表列出此查詢支援的參數。這裡列出的參數全都是查詢參數。

參數
必要參數
part string
part 參數會指定 API 回應會包含的 videoCategory 資源屬性。將參數值設為 snippet
篩選器 (請僅指定下列其中一個參數)
id string
id 參數會針對要擷取的資源,指定以半形逗號分隔的影片類別 ID 清單。
regionCode string
regionCode 參數會指示 API 傳回指定國家/地區可用的影片類別清單。參數值採用 ISO 3166-1 alpha-2 國家/地區代碼。
選用參數
hl string
hl 參數會指定 API 回應中的文字值應使用的語言。預設值為 en_US

要求主體

呼叫此方法時,不要提供要求主體。

回應

如果成功的話,這個方法會傳回回應內文,其結構如下:

{
 
"kind": "youtube#videoCategoryListResponse",
 
"etag": etag,
 
"nextPageToken": string,
 
"prevPageToken": string,
 
"pageInfo": {
   
"totalResults": integer,
   
"resultsPerPage": integer
 
},
 
"items": [
   
videoCategory resource
 
]
}

屬性

下表定義了這項資源中顯示的屬性:

屬性
kind string
識別 API 資源的類型。值為 youtube#videoCategoryListResponse
etag etag
這項資源的 Etag。
nextPageToken string
可做為 pageToken 參數值的權杖,用於擷取結果集中的下一頁。
prevPageToken string
可做為 pageToken 參數值的權杖,擷取結果集中的上一頁。
pageInfo object
pageInfo 物件會封裝結果集的分頁資訊。
pageInfo.totalResults integer
結果集的結果總數。
pageInfo.resultsPerPage integer
API 回應中包含的結果數量。
items[] list
可與 YouTube 影片建立關聯的影片類別清單。在此地圖中,影片類別 ID 為地圖鍵,而其值是對應的 videoCategory 資源。

錯誤

下表列出 API 回應此方法時可能傳回的錯誤訊息。詳情請參閱錯誤訊息的說明文件。

錯誤類型 錯誤詳細資料 說明
notFound (404) videoCategoryNotFound 找不到 id 參數識別的影片類別。使用 videoCategories.list 方法擷取有效值的清單。